Факторы, определяющие рост ВВП Китая: эмпирический анализ макроэкономических переменных

https://doi.org/10.26794/2304-022X-2025-15-1-20-35

Аннотация

Целью исследования явился анализ влияния прямых иностранных инвестиций (ПИИ), торговли и различных макроэкономических факторов на рост ВВП в Китае за период 1982–2022 гг. С помощью модели авторегрессии с распределенным лагом (ARDL) исследовалась динамическая взаимосвязь между ростом ВВП и пятнадцатью независимыми переменными, включая ПИИ, экспорт, торговлю, общий долг и реальные процентные ставки. Результаты ARDL-модели указывают на значительное долгосрочное влияние некоторых переменных, в частности баланса текущего счета, экспорта и торговли товарами. Краткосрочная динамика показала, что увеличение ПИИ и реальных процентных ставок положительно влияет на рост ВВП, а увеличение долга, экспорта и конечного потребления — отрицательно. Тест границ ARDL подтверждает долгосрочную связь между переменными. Диагностические проверки не выявили    проблем с нормальностью, гетероскедастичностью или серийной корреляцией. Этот всесторонний анализ предоставляет ценные данные для разработки эффективной экономической политики, способствующей устойчивому росту и стабильности в быстро развивающейся экономике Китая.
